Comprehending Legal Legal Right
Comprehending your legal rights is critical when browsing the complexities of the legal system. Understanding what you're qualified to under the regulation can considerably influence the end result of your instance. You're not simply an onlooker in your lawful battles; you're an energetic participant with legal rights that secure you.
Firstly, you have the right to remain silent. This isn't just a line in flicks; it's your guard versus self-incrimination. Whatever you say can undoubtedly be made use of versus you, so recognizing the power of silence is critical.
You likewise deserve to be represented by an attorney. Whether you employ one or have actually one selected, lawful depiction is your essential right. It guarantees you have a specialist to navigate the lawful intricacies and supporter on your behalf.
Additionally, you're entitled to a fair test. This implies being attempted in a competent court, by an objective court, and without unnecessary delay. You likewise can challenge witnesses against you, which allows your protection to cross-examine the prosecution's witnesses and challenge their testimony.
Recognizing these legal rights empowers you to take an energetic role in your protection and helps secure your flexibility and future.
Methods in Defense
Why should you understand the best protection strategies? As you browse the intricacies of a criminal situation, understanding numerous protection tactics can substantially influence the outcome. Your lawyer's method to your defense might vary based on the evidence, the nature of the costs, and local laws. Below's what you ought to understand about crafting the defense approach.
Firstly, determining variances or errors in the prosecution's proof is essential. Your attorney will certainly scrutinize every detail, trying to find gaps that can be manipulated to your advantage. They could likewise test the admissibility of proof if it was incorrectly acquired, thus damaging the prosecution's case.
Secondly, think about the alibi defense. If you weren't at the scene of the criminal activity, evidence of your location could be key. This involves celebration qualified witnesses or concrete proof to support your insurance claim of being elsewhere.
Additionally, protection is one more technique, suitable if you're accused of a violent crime and you believe you were securing yourself. Showing that you 'd a sensible belief of impending injury which your action was in proportion can be reliable.
Each approach requires thorough prep work and a deep understanding of legal criteria and civil liberties. Your lawyer's role is to customize these methods to fit the specifics of your instance, going for the best possible result.
Trial Prep Work and Representation
After discovering protection techniques, it is essential to concentrate on exactly how your attorney will certainly get ready for trial and represent you in court. Your legal representative's duty changes dramatically as they move from intending to action.
Initially, they'll gather and examine all proof, ensuring they know the instance completely. This includes depositions, witness declarations, and any physical proof that may influence your test.
Next, your lawyer will create an engaging story. They'll craft a tale that lines up with the proof however likewise humanizes you to the court. This story is critical; it's the backbone of your defense, made to reverberate with jurors' feelings and logic.
Mock tests might be performed to improve debates and expect prosecution techniques. Your attorney will likewise make a decision whether you should affirm, which can be a crucial choice in your case.
Throughout the actual trial, anticipate your attorney to be assertive. They'll test variances in the prosecution's evidence and cross-examine witnesses to highlight uncertainties concerning their dependability or reliability.
